How much do part time accounting j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time accounting in Georgia is $18.64,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.82 and $20.72 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a part time accounting professional?

To thrive as a Part Time Accounting professional, you need a solid understanding of basic accounting principles, proficiency in bookkeeping, and often an associate’s degree or relevant coursework in accounting. Familiarity with accounting software like QuickBooks, Excel, and possibly experience with ERP systems is highly valuable. Attention to detail, time management, and strong organizational skills help individuals excel in balancing multiple clients or tasks within limited hours. These skills and qualifications ensure accurate financial records, effective workflow, and compliance with reporting standards, which are crucial for supporting business operations.

What is a part time accounting?

A part time accounting job involves performing accounting tasks, such as bookkeeping, preparing financial reports, managing invoices, and reconciling accounts, but on a reduced schedule compared to a full-time role. These positions are ideal for individuals seeking flexibility, such as students, parents, or those supplementing other work. Part time accountants may work for businesses, accounting firms, or as independent contractors, and their responsibilities can vary depending on the employer's needs.

How does a part-time accounting role typically integrate with full-time accounting staff and broader finance teams?

Part-time accountants usually work closely with full-time staff by focusing on specific tasks such as reconciliations, data entry, or assisting with month-end closings. They often coordinate with full-time accountants to ensure consistency and accuracy in financial records, and may attend regular team meetings to stay aligned on priorities. Communication is key, as part-time team members need to stay updated on ongoing projects and deadlines. While their schedules are more flexible, part-time accountants are expected to maintain high standards of organization and responsiveness to support the overall finance team’s objectives.
